Output 52ff10e649a013153b54a8c6df6c94fc2871f7ed144fdeff224ad86a26aa2830:0

value
6947025627917
script pubkey
OP_0 OP_PUSHBYTES_20 74dcc00de6a66da007cfd463b89939b32224d664
address
tb1qwnwvqr0x5ek6qp70633m3xfekv3zf4nyk04wdz
transaction
52ff10e649a013153b54a8c6df6c94fc2871f7ed144fdeff224ad86a26aa2830
confirmations
173090
spent
true